Do the infrared space heaters (1500 watts) really save any money in heating costs?

    Infrared heaters do require less energy to run than a heating unit, but they tend to put off heat in small areas, which causes the homeowner to run them for quite some time to heat the entire room/area, etc. In my experience its 6 of one-half a dozen of another. However, they are great for small spaces over a short amount of time.
  • Amy, Good input from Shane. Just to reiterate, there is nothing efficient about electric infrared space heaters. The only possible way to save money using them is to turn the whole-house system down far enough that it significantly reduces that monthly utility bill more than it costs to run the space heater to heat a small area...i.e.: wherever you are sitting.   • Space heaters are also very bad for the electrical system in your home as homeowners often overload their circuits causing breakers to trip and damage outlets misusing or over using them. Not to mention their obvious fire hazards.
